Create a New Scenario to Connect Google Programmable Search Engine and Data Enrichment
In the workspace, click the “Create New Scenario” button.
Add the First Step
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a Google Programmable Search Engine, triggered by another scenario, or executed manually (for testing purposes). In most cases, Google Programmable Search Engine or Data Enrichment will be your first step. To do this, click "Choose an app," find Google Programmable Search Engine or Data Enrichment, and select the appropriate trigger to start the scenario.

Save and Activate the Scenario
After configuring Google Programmable Search Engine, Data Enrichment,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.
Test the Scenario
Run the scenario by clicking “Run once” and triggering an event to check if the Google Programmable Search Engine and Data Enrichment integration works as expected. Depending on your setup, data should flow between Google Programmable Search Engine and Data Enrichment (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.
Google Programmable Search Engine + Data Enrichment + Google Sheets: When a new row is added to a Google Sheet, the information is used to query Google Programmable Search Engine. The search results are then enriched using Data Enrichment, and finally, the enriched data is added as a new row to the Google Sheet.
Google Programmable Search Engine + Data Enrichment + Salesforce: Use Google Programmable Search Engine to query data. Enrich the results using Data Enrichment. Create a new lead in Salesforce with the enriched data.
